Deep Plane Facelift: Things To Know

For longer-lasting results and a more intensive approach, a deep plane facelift works beneath the skin to adjust the deeper layers of the face. Unlike other facelift techniques that mainly tighten the skin or reposition the more superficial layers, a deep plane facelift involves releasing and repositioning the muscle and connective tissue. Bulbous Nose and Rhinoplasty Surgery

A bulbous nose is a nasal shape where the tip appears round, wide, or prominent due to the way the cartilage and skin form at the lower part of the nose. Some people have this shape naturally due to genetics, while for others, it can develop or become more noticeable over time. Rhinoplasty can be used to change the structure...
